To provide a low temperature fluid joint minimizing the leakage of low temperature fluid without the need for gasification.
The front end face of a female side poppet valve 30 and the front end face of a male side poppet valve 40 are shaped to approximately correspond to each other when opposed to each other. To a sliding ring body 13, a bellows 20 is connected with liquid tight which is expandable in the axial direction and has a flow path for the low temperature fluid on the inner periphery side. A front end cylinder portion 54 thrusts the sliding ring body 13 while abutting thereon, whereby the sliding ring body 13 is moved relative to the female side poppet valve 30 to open the female side poppet valve 30. The front end face of the female side poppet valve 30 thrusts the male side poppet valve 40 while abutting thereon, whereby the male side poppet valve 40 is opened.
